EXPO 2025 OSAKA: CONFINDUSTRIA AND THE COMMISSARIAT GENERAL FOR ITALY AT EXPO 2025 OSAKA SIGN AGREEMENT TO ENSURE MAXIMUM PARTICIPATION OF THE ITALIAN INDUSTRIAL SYSTEM

Rome, 10 July 2024 - Ensuring maximum participation of Italian industrial system companies in Expo 2025 Osaka. This is the main objective of the Memorandum of Understanding signed today by Confindustria and the General Commissariat for Italy at Expo 2025 Osaka, in Rome at the Confindustria headquarters. The agreement will also make it possible to promote tourism and territories, support the internationalisation of production chains and attract investments, enhancing our technologies and Italian know-how. The agreement, signed by Barbara Cimmino, Confindustria Vice President for Export and Investment Attraction, and by Mario Vattani, Commissioner General for Italy at Expo 2025 Osaka, in view of the World Expo, consolidates the collaboration between the two institutions in developing connections between Italian companies and potential new foreign partners to facilitate the development of economic relations and trade agreements.
Also present at the meeting was Matteo Zoppas, President of the ICE Agency, to underline the Agency's commitment to the promotion of business activities on foreign markets. Support is fundamental to enhance the value of Made in Italy and contribute to the internationalisation of companies in the Asian area, of which Expo 2025 Osaka will be an important driving force.
 
"Identifying projects to be involved, in close connection with the Associations of the System, favouring the most significant ones in relation to the Asia-Pacific Area and the countries considered strategic, creating opportunities for meeting and sharing with associated companies, bodies, institutions, and academies with which the Commissariat has established collaboration agreements, promoting, in partnership with the public system, the organisation of outgoing and incoming missions to Japan to start direct collaborations with bodies and operators in the Area and encourage contacts between Italian companies and their counterparts of interest. These are some of the objectives of the Memorandum of Understanding signed today with the Commissioner General for Italy at Expo 2025 Osaka, Mario Vattani, which will see us engaged for the next few months in defining a shared plan of activities to facilitate the aggregation of resources and skills in the Italian business world, in which companies will be the real protagonists, in relation to the themes and projects of Italian participation in Expo 2025,' said the Vice President of Confindustria, Barbara Cimmino.

"For one semester, the Italian Pavilion at Expo 2025 Osaka will be an effective tool for promoting our excellence in Japan and Asia, a region characterised by young, fast-growing markets," commented the Commissioner General for Italy at Expo 2025 Osaka, Amb. Mario Vattani. "In addition to dedicated spaces where it is possible to present projects and organise events, companies coming to Expo will find themselves supported by the services offered by a network of institutions and trade associations with which we have signed cooperation agreements in recent months. The partnership with Confindustria is an important element of this internationalisation path'.

For Matteo Zoppas, President ICE AgencyExpo 2025 Osaka is an event that combines promotion and development of Made in Italy, which represent the main activities of the ICE Agency. The World Expo is in fact a unique showcase for Italian products and for the growth of exports, not only in the local market but also in Japan and throughout the Asian continent. Agenzia ICE through its network of offices could contribute to the Osaka Expo by organising the incoming of qualified operators and buyers with the aim of creating moments of business matching and laying the foundations for further development of Italian companies in the area. In Japan, Made in Italy exports in 2023 reached 8 billion euro, made up of products of excellence in terms of quality, innovation and technology with great prospects for growth. Expo 2025 Osaka will therefore be an opportunity not to be missed to capitalise on the attractiveness of Made in Italy through the contribution that the entire Country System, represented by ICE, Sace, Simest and Cdp, together with the great commitment of the Government, will offer to the companies and associations that will participate. The best ambassador at the Expo of things beautiful and well made in Italy: Made in Italy'.

Expo 2025 will be held in Osaka from 13 April to 13 October 2025 under the theme 'Designing the society of the future for our lives'. Italy will present itself with a Pavilion designed by architect Mario Cucinella with the slogan 'Art Regenerates Life'. More than 30 million visitors are expected. This Universal Exposition will be an important opportunity of integrated promotion for Italian companies in the Asia-Pacific area in which to present the 'state of the art' of our country: from design to agro-food, from fashion to technology, from infrastructures and urban planning to energy, from science to industry with in-depth studies on aerospace, robotics, life sciences and high technology up to pharmaceuticals and biomedicals.
